This session emphasizes the importance of universal design for learning (UDL) in the early childhood classroom. We'll outline ways that teachers can create, plan, and teach using UDL principles such as multiple ways of engagement and multiple means of representation with action and expression in learning. Adding UDL principles to planning and teaching isn't just for children with disabilities. All children benefit from having multiple means of learning without being limited by traditional teaching methods that exclude many children from showcasing their full potential. Throughout the session, we'll explore practical, low-cost ways to create or modify materials and use technology resources to meet children where they are today and help them build the skills and confidence to achieve even more tomorrow.
